 Yellow Hoop Petticoat Species Daffodil
The Daffodil 'Yellow Hoop Petticoat', 'Narcissi species', is a fall planted bulb. This tiny Narcissus with its unusual aster-like flowers blooms extremely early in the spring at the same time as the Crocus. It is a real eye catcher, despite it's small size. It is easy to grow and to colonize. They will multiply and produce the most abundant flowering results in the 2nd and 3rd year. If necessary, very large clumps of bulbs can be lifted as soon as the leaves wither, and then they can be divided and replanted as soon as possible. The plants are deer, rabbit, and squirrel resistant.
